since we now have real touch events in GWT (which we did not have when mgwt
started) we could think about cutting back on our touch events with the next
mgwt release and actual introduce some breaking changes here.
The other reason we are not using GWT touch events is that we need TouchEvents
that can be used in unit tests. There might be an easy way of solving this
though.
